The YAMAHA KLW-M715A-000 Muffler Filter is a compact pneumatic maintenance component designed for the placement head ejector system of YSM10 and YSM20 SMT mounters. The part is associated with the ejector air circuit and is installed within the head pneumatic assembly to support controlled exhaust during repeated pick-and-place operation.
In high-speed SMT production, the placement head continuously performs component pickup, transfer, placement, vacuum release, and pneumatic switching. Small pneumatic components therefore need to remain clean and correctly installed to maintain consistent head operation.

The placement head of an SMT mounter performs a very large number of pneumatic cycles during production. Each pickup and placement process requires coordinated vacuum generation, pneumatic switching, and air release.
Over time, several operating conditions may affect the muffler.
Fine particles can enter or accumulate around pneumatic components. Dust, component packaging debris, general factory contamination, and maintenance residue may gradually affect airflow.
A muffler that becomes heavily contaminated may create additional resistance in the exhaust path. This can affect pneumatic response and should be investigated during head maintenance.
Small pneumatic parts experience continuous operating cycles. Even when there is no visible failure, aging or contamination may justify inspection during scheduled maintenance.
When the ejector assembly is already being serviced, inspecting the muffler is an efficient preventive maintenance step.
Vacuum or pickup problems can originate from multiple components. The muffler may be one inspection point, but technicians should also check the nozzle, valves, air pressure, ejector, vacuum path, and related head components.
| Production Symptom | Recommended Inspection Area |
|---|---|
| Unstable component pickup | Nozzle, vacuum path, ejector |
| Slow pneumatic response | Valve, muffler, air supply |
| Abnormal exhaust sound | Muffler and air passage |
| Head vacuum alarm | Vacuum system and sensors |
| Repeated pickup errors | Nozzle, ejector, pneumatic circuit |
| Visible contamination | Muffler and surrounding assembly |

The KLW-M715A-000 operates as part of the placement head pneumatic system.
Compressed air enters the placement head pneumatic circuit.
The ejector uses compressed air to create the vacuum required for component pickup.
Vacuum is transferred through the placement head to the nozzle so that the component can be securely picked from the feeder.
The head moves the component to the programmed PCB location and completes placement.
Air leaving the ejector system passes through the exhaust path. The muffler helps manage pneumatic exhaust in this circuit.
SMT production requires repeated operation at high speed. A clean and correctly installed pneumatic system helps maintain predictable response during continuous production.

When troubleshooting vacuum instability, do not assume that the muffler is the only cause.
Check the complete system.
| Check Point | Possible Problem |
|---|---|
| Nozzle | Blockage or wear |
| Vacuum Passage | Leakage or contamination |
| Ejector | Reduced performance |
| Pneumatic Valve | Slow switching |
| Muffler | Restricted exhaust |
| Air Supply | Low or unstable pressure |
| Sensor | Incorrect vacuum feedback |
